About
Rifugio Escursionistico Vulpot sits at 1805m in the Maritime Alps of Piedmont. Reach it from the Pian della Casa trailhead via a 2-hour hike through mixed forest and alpine meadow. The refuge is a solid base for day walks into the surrounding peaks and valleys. Winter snow often blocks access from November to May, so check conditions before traveling.
The hut runs 24 beds across 14 private rooms, making it practical for small groups or families. Half-board (overnight plus breakfast and dinner) is available. The kitchen provides simple, hearty mountain food. Water comes from the spring; there's no shower. The refuge stays open seasonally from late spring through early autumn—confirm exact dates before booking.
Email the hut directly at the contact address or call ahead. Summer weekends fill quickly, especially July and August. Book at least 4–6 weeks ahead for peak season. Off-season (June and September) you can often arrange stays with shorter notice. Specify room preferences and dietary needs when you contact them.
